JavaScriptだけでちょっとしたコンテンツを作成してみました。
Google Feed API(以下GF API) を使用して iTunes の Feed を取得し、ランキングされたアルバム名(曲名) or アーティスト名をキーワードにGoogle Search API(以下GS API)を使用して検索をかけるというものです。
Keyword Search@iTunes Store:Today's Ranking
ランキングされているアーチスト名を見て「誰それ?」とか、聞いたことがない曲がランキングされているのを見て「ちょっと見てみたい」「聞いてみたい」という衝動が湧いてきたりする。
これは私だけではないはず…、ということはニーズがあるかな?と思い製作開始。とりあえず形になったのでアップました。
中身(ソース)は今後ボチボチ修正していこうと考えています。
似たようなサイトは他にあるかもしれませんが、これはPHPなどを使わずにJavaScriptだけで作られているところが注目出来る点では。(自画自賛)
Usage
ページ左側のサイドバーにあるメニューから、表示するランキングを切り替えます。表示されているランキングの『アルバム名』『曲名』もしくは『アーティスト名』をクリックするとそれをキーワードに検索します。
上図、赤い枠で囲まれた文字列が検索するキーワードになります。
Option
- Entry - 表示するランキングの数
- Visible -
- [ Title Only ] - タイトルとアーティスト名のみ表示
- [ Full ] - 全て表示
- Country - 国の指定(指定した国のランキングを表示)
検索結果の表示
検索結果はページ右側に表示されます。- ビデオ
- イメージ
- ウェブ
- ニュース
▽免責事項▽
該当サイトをご利用した際に起こったいかなる損害も、制作者 Y@$ 及び humming bird はその責を負いません。ご自身の責任においてご利用ください。
更新履歴
2008/09/12:- jQueryを導入。slideToggleを使用してメニューとランキングの見せ方を変えた。
- GF APIとGS APIのデフォルトのCSSを読み込まないように修正。
『!important』を使用しなくとも良くなったのでIE6以下のブラウザでのページの崩れをなくした。(つもり) - ランキングタイトルの検索文字列の修正。
- IE6に対応(したつもり)
0 Comments:
コメントを投稿